Output f868f992a89574101dc4777309d8bae703f674a5fdd4dbddfbad8be2a577ee9a:1

value
63841712
script pubkey
OP_0 OP_PUSHBYTES_20 e0b31d7c16acad7aed5ac2076248becba41da51e
address
bc1quze36lqk4jkh4m26cgrkyj97ewjpmfg7f9j2ym
transaction
f868f992a89574101dc4777309d8bae703f674a5fdd4dbddfbad8be2a577ee9a
confirmations
377956
spent
true